To obtain the number of grams of CO2 emitted per gallon of gasoline combusted, the heat content of the fuel per gallon is multiplied by the kg CO2 per heat content of the fuel. The average heat content per gallon of gasoline is 0.125 mmbtu/gallon and the average emissions per heat content of gasoline is 71.35 kg CO2/mmbtu.

A gallon of gasoline vapor does not have a constant weight because its density can vary based on temperature, pressure, and composition. However, the weight of a gallon of gasoline liquid at room temperature is about 6.3 pounds.

Equivalent in what way? Gasoline and water are two entirely different chemical compounds. They have dissimilar physical and chemical properties because, well, they are different. Perhaps you are referring specifically to the weight of a gallon of each. If so, then the weight of a gallon of each substance is not equivalent because the gas is less dense than water, so a gallon of water weighs more. When referring to volume, a gallon of gas is equivalent to a gallon of water. Even a gallon of oxygen is equivalent to a gallon of water, in reference to volume. However, when dealing with gases, pressure, temperature, and the number of molecules of the gas must be taken into account.
